A text message will be sent to anyone who has received a positive COVID-19 test result. The message contains instructions for reporting exposed persons in the MyCovidData.fi service. The service is used in the HUS area in all municipalities except Helsinki. Helsinki has its own system for reporting liabilities.
โ The information provided in the service is useful preliminary information for markers of infections and speeds up traceability. The service can be used to report all places where the infected person has been, and to write the names and telephone numbers of the exposed people and all other information related to the exposure, โ says the assistant chief physician. Eeva Ruotsalainen.
When the data is registered before calling the infection tracer, the data can be checked together and supplemented if necessary. The infectious marker confirms the exposure.
Use of the service requires strong authentication with online banking IDs or a mobile certificate. It is also possible to use the service on behalf of another person.
The service is now available in Finnish. The Swedish and English versions of the service will be launched soon. In addition to the municipalities in the HUS area, the service can be introduced in the hospital districts of Kymote, Eksote and Northern Ostrobothnia.
The address of the service is MyCovidData.fi.
